Dr. Kevin J. O'Keefe

4.1 ( 20 reviews )

Helpfulness

Knowledge

Ratings for Dr. Kevin J. O'Keefe

5
Staff
3
Punctuality
5
Helpfulness
5
Knowledge

Dr. O'Keefe has been my primary doctor for 17 years through good and bad times. He is above all a caring person and he actually listens. Each visit is a mini-medical lesson as he shares knowledge at an understandable level. Top these qualities off with his present nurse assistant (Shannon) who is equally as caring, compassionate and incredibly responsive and you know you are in good hands!

Submitted June 8, 2015

5
Staff
3
Punctuality
5
Helpfulness
5
Knowledge

Been going to Dr O'Keefe a little over two years now. He is the best doctor I have ever had (and I am in my 50s). He actually listens and is not in a hurry to push you out the door. Anytime I have called in or emailed in with questions someone has helped me very quickly. I the fact I can email questions as a lot of times I don't need to play phone games and actually talk to someone. Have NEVER had a problem with anyone on his staff and speak highly of them. Nice to have a Quest lab on site for tests as well. Suggestion: Try to get early appointments as he does run behind because he does spend time with patients that need it. That's really not a bad thing. Just some people have no patience to wait a bit.

Submitted Dec. 1, 2014

1
Staff
1
Punctuality
3
Helpfulness
5
Knowledge

Dr. Okeefe is a great doctor, although his secretary thinks she has the power to give out medical advice wth out talking to him is crazy, she gets irrate and yells at the patients with threatening words that he will fire me as a patient when we argue back at her, he is great his secretary needs to learn manners and respect.
or find another job

Submitted Nov. 3, 2014

5
Staff
4
Punctuality
5
Helpfulness
5
Knowledge

We have been with GAMG and Dr. O'Keefe for 20 years. He is the best. Thoroughly knowledgeable and good "beside manner". The GAMG electronic system/patient portal is very convenient and the staff and Dr. O'Keefe are prompt to respond to requests and questions. 5 Star rating! Rated only lower on punctuality because you always have to wait in a doctor's office but that is always due to taking a little extra time with a patient when necessary...and we are always grateful when that patient is us!

Submitted July 16, 2014

3
Staff
2
Punctuality
5
Helpfulness
5
Knowledge

Dr. O'Keefe is an excellent doctor. He has cared and guided me for over 20 years. I love the fact that he gives me all the time I need to explain issues. He always has solid recommendations. I am so fortunate to have him as my doctor. He is the best.

Submitted June 4, 2014

3
Staff
4
Punctuality
5
Helpfulness
5
Knowledge

The only doctor that I trust. He is the BEST! He has always given me sound and practical advice. I consider myself extremely lucky to have him in my corner.

Submitted Feb. 25, 2013

5
Staff
3
Punctuality
5
Helpfulness
5
Knowledge

Although he rarely is on time, once you get into the exam room and see Dr. O'Keefe he gives you all the time that is needed to completely assess your health care needs and answer questions that arise. He is the most knowledgeable physician I have ever met, and being in the health care field myself, this says a lot about this wonderful doc.

Submitted Jan. 30, 2013

4
Staff
4
Punctuality
5
Helpfulness
5
Knowledge

Dr. O'Keefe is an excellent doctor, very knowledgeable and caring. He is always accessible by e-mail. I trust his judgement.

Submitted Sept. 11, 2012

2
Staff
3
Punctuality
5
Helpfulness
5
Knowledge

Dr. O'Keefe is seldom "on time", but that is a positive thing as he is busy spending quality time with his patients. Once he arrives in the exam room, he has a way of making one feel that he has all the time in the world just to focus on "your" problem. His staff is a complety seperate entity---"frustrating" is the best word that I can use. There are a few members of his staff who are very helpful, but most of them need a "redo"! Unfortunately this is a bad reflection on the practice as the "staff" is the first line of contact and can leave one with a poor impression of the practice. My husband and I have found that if we email Dr. O'Keefe personally through the Patient Portal, we will get much better results. During the 15 years that we have been with Dr. O'Keefe, he has guided and educated us along the way---we are very thankful to have him, especially at this time of our lives.

Submitted March 21, 2012

4
Staff
4
Punctuality
5
Helpfulness
5
Knowledge

Great focus on preventative treatment and treatment of chronic problems. Quite approachable.

Submitted July 27, 2011

Facility Affiliations


Dr. Kevin J. O'Keefe's Credentials

Education

  • Univ Of Md Sch Of Med, Baltimore Md 21201 (Grad. 1985)

Insurance accepted by this Doctor

Other patients have successfully used these insurance providers, please call the Doctor's office to find out if your insurance plan is accepted.
Blue Cross / Blue Shield
Cigna
Coventry Healthcare
  • Coventry
Medicare
UnitedHealthcare